I have a problem with Microsoft Office Outlook View Control in Office 2010 and 64 bit operation system.
The foxpro says me - Class is not registered. I try to do it manually use regsvr32.. - problem still the same.
Normally, In FoxPro - add ActiveX component to the toolbox I can see a list of all Office ActiveX controls, but in case with Winodws 7 64 bit - the office controls are not listed.

I thinking the problem happens because foxpro is 32 bit application, and in 64 bit OS - registry files is different of different application which read it. So, from 32 bit application position, the library not registered. (not sure, but it seems so)

Any idea how to get it work
